From first glance, "Diana and Actaeon" is a vivid exploration of color and form, but diving deeper, one realizes it is a modern retelling of an ancient myth. This painting, inspired by the well-known myth of Diana and Actaeon, speaks volumes through its intricate use of lines and bold color choices. The title immediately sets the tone, referencing the tragic tale where Actaeon, the hunter, stumbles upon Diana, the chaste goddess of the hunt, during her bath. As punishment, he is transformed into a stag and is eventually hunted by his own hounds. The painting employs a fusion of biomorphic and geometric shapes to narrate this transformation. The swirling patterns of teal and green might be seen as both the fluidity of Diana's bathing waters and the tumultuous fate that engulfs Actaeon. One could argue that the interspersed dark spots and tints symbolize the moment of realization, or perhaps the ever-looming shadow of doom that hangs over Actaeon's fate. What's particularly striking is the chosen medium. The artist has beautifully harmonized watercolor, watercolor pencils, acrylic, and ink, crafting depth and texture throughout the piece. This mix of mediums gives the artwork a dynamic appearance, where the watercolor provides a soft, fluid background, while the acrylic and ink impart definition and intensity. "Diana and Actaeon" is not just an abstract portrayal but a layered narrative piece. The artist has taken a classical theme and provided a contemporary lens, pushing viewers to introspect on themes of fate, and transformation. Luna Ljus, a multidisciplinary artist originating from Brazil, presents a diverse portfolio centered around the motif of metamorphosis. Her creations resonate with profound shifts—be they physical, emotional, or historical. Drawing from a rich tapestry of inspirations, including mythology, sci-fi, and the annals of art history. Ljus's invites audiences to a realm where the present moment is momentarily set aside, allowing for a cathartic journey through emotion, only to circle back with a rejuvenated perspective. Employing a blend of the abstract and the literal, she reimagines literary, fictional, and historical themes, often through a kaleidoscope of vibrant hues. At the heart of her repertoire is the notion of transformation. Each piece, echoing life's cyclical dance of birth, decay, and rebirth, beckons onlookers to ponder the depths of change. Her visual lexicon unfolds with a mix of geometric musings and organic shapes, painting dreams and hinting at alternate dimensions. There's a deliberate interplay of color and form—a testament to her infatuation with their symbiotic relationship. Ljus's canvases pulsate with energy, largely credited to her choice of spirited, juxtaposed colors. The echoes of Fauvism, Cubism, and Abstract Expressionism, particularly the traces of Orphism and color field techniques, are undeniable in her work. Moreover, the recurring patterns and symbols in her pieces are deliberate nods to mythology, science fiction, and the annals of art history. Ljus's meticulous method involves a profound exploration of narrative through the prism of elementary forms and vivid colors, often blurring the lines between the abstract and the definitive. Her penchant for the tactile essence of paper and water-soluble pigments pushes her to constantly experiment with varied mediums, crafting semi-abstract artworks. Each creation undergoes an intriguing evolution. Beginning with a detailed watercolor foundation, the piece is subject to alterations in color fields and strokes over days or even weeks, reflecting the evolving thoughts and sentiments that sparked its inception. This fluid process sometimes yields unforeseen motifs, adding serendipitous layers to her work. Ljus's oeuvre is thoughtfully segmented into series: "Renewals" delves into the nuances of change. "Strange Worlds" is a poetic contemplation of alternate realities and entities.
